Yes, in bearded dragons sex reversal takes place when the temperature is 32 degrees and above. In these dragons the sex chromosome for male is ZZ and female is ZW . During higher temperatures at incubation the male ones gets driven into female but their genetic comnposition still be ZZ. Their male characteristics disappear and they even lay eggs.

Experiment - The eggs of the bearded dragons are placed in incubator and the temperature is maintained below 32 degrees. The eggs should be kept in position as they were initially found. The region found at the top should be placed in the incubator at the top side only.

Control - The eggs are incubated below 32 degrees and it is used as control.

Yes, infant colic is related to microbial community. Lower amounts of clostridium species and higher amounts of Bifidiobacterial sp. have reduced colic symptoms. Lactobacilus is also low in colic infants.

Experiment - Fecal microbiota in infants with colic who are below 100 days are collected . It is screened for lactobacili and bifidobacteria sp. 10 test samples are taken.

Control - Exactly 10 control samples are taken from infants of equal weight and age.
